SubjectRe: [PATCH 3/5] pinctrl: core: Add generic pinctrl functions for managing groups
On Tue, Dec 27, 2016 at 6:20 PM, Tony Lindgren <tony@atomide.com> wrote:

> We can add generic helpers for function handling for cases where the pin
> controller driver does not need to use static arrays.
>
> Signed-off-by: Tony Lindgren <tony@atomide.com>

Patch applied.

> +config GENERIC_PINMUX
> + bool
> + select PINMUX

I renamed this GENERIC_PINMUX_FUNCTIONS

> + INIT_RADIX_TREE(&pctldev->pin_function_tree, GFP_KERNEL);

#ifdefed this

> + struct radix_tree_root pin_function_tree;
> unsigned int num_groups;
> + unsigned int num_functions;

#ifdefed these

> /**
> + * struct function_desc - generic function descriptor
> + * @name: name of the function
> + * @group_names: array of pin group names
> + * @num_group_names: number of pin group names
> + * @data: pin controller driver specific data
> + */
> +struct function_desc {
> + const char *name;
> + const char **group_names;
> + int num_group_names;
> + void *data;
> +};

And moved this into pinmux.h
